NHL Winter Classic 2009, broadcast New Year's Day on NBC, was the most-viewed NHL regular season game in almost 34 years. An average of more than 4.4 million Americans watched the Detroit Red Wings defeat the Chicago Blackhawks 6-4 from historic Wrigley Field, a 17 percent increase over last year's inaugural Winter Classic (3.75 million) and the biggest audience since Feb. 23, 1975 (5.4 million, Philadelphia-New York Rangers on NBC), according to Nielsen Media Research. The game earned a 2.5 national rating and a 5 share (1-4:15 p.m. ET), a 14 percent increase over last year's inaugural event (2.2/4, 1-4:45 p.m. ET).
